Yes!
Prep by sanding so all surfaces are dull, then clean the cabinets with a little TSP (tto sodium phosphate.)
The primer is super important. You want to use one that has a stain blocker like Zinzer brand. A good paint store or box store will have it and a paint check can help you. Prime with two good coats and sand between.
With enamel use a brush and always paint in the direction of the wood grain. Paint thin coats and sand with fine grit paper. I do three coats, but do higher end renovations to last. Some folks use a clear varithane on top, but I haven't found it necessary.
There is a lot online that will give you precise info on how to do this. These are the basics.
